database.sarang.net
UserID
Passwd
Database
DBMS
MySQL
ㆍPostgreSQL
Firebird
Oracle
Informix
Sybase
MS-SQL
DB2
Cache
CUBRID
LDAP
ALTIBASE
Tibero
DB 문서들
스터디
Community
공지사항
자유게시판
구인|구직
DSN 갤러리
도움주신분들
Admin
운영게시판
최근게시물
PostgreSQL Q&A 7386 게시물 읽기
No. 7386
DMZ zone에 있는 web server에서 내부망에 있는 DB를 사용하는데
작성자
박성철(gyumee)
작성일
2008-04-01 14:57
조회수
7,469

DMZ zone에 있는 web server에서 내부망에 있는 DB를 사용하는데

DMZ zone의 원칙 상 DMZ zone에서 내부로의 접속을 허용되지  않는다면

어떻게 하시겠어요?


지금 생각은 DMZ의 웹서버에서 DB로 접속해서 작업할 작업을 웹서버와 같은 박스에 있는 메세지 큐에 넣어놓고

내부 망의 DB서버 쪽에서는 이 큐의 내용을 폴링해 가서 처리 한 후에 다시 큐에 넣어주는 식으로 하면 될 것 같은데


왠지 이런 일이 특별한 일도 아니고 다른 솔루션이 있을 것 같다는 생각이 드네요.


보통 이런 상황에서는 어떤 방법을 사용하나요?

이 글에 대한 댓글이 총 3건 있습니다.

아무리 검색해봐도

그냥 DMZ에서 DB로 접속하는 커넥션을 허용하도록 방화벽을 설정하게 하네요.


우씨... 근데 우리 클라이언트는 절대 안된다고...ㅠ.ㅠ


대안은 두번째 DMZ을 두고 그곳에 proxy를 설치한 다음 DB 접속이 그 proxy를 거쳐서 내부에 들어오게 하는 것인데 방충망 하나 더 있다는 것 빼고는 결국 내부 접속이 되야 한다는...


그런데 이렇게 하면 방화벽을 하나 더 설치해야 하니 배보다 배꼽이...


pgsql말고 oracle로 바꾸자고 한 다음 oracle 컨설팅 회사에 책임을 미뤄버려야겠어요. ;;;

박성철(gyumee)님이 2008-04-02 09:55에 작성한 댓글입니다.
이 댓글은 2008-04-02 09:56에 마지막으로 수정되었습니다.

그냥 생각하기로는

내부망 DB 서버로 부터 DMZ web 서버로 SSH 터널을 생성하면 ,
DMZ web 서버는 내부망 DB에 접근가능하겠죠

그냥님이 2008-04-02 13:22에 작성한 댓글입니다.
이 댓글은 2008-04-02 13:29에 마지막으로 수정되었습니다. Edit

ㅎㅎ

핵킹 수준이군요.


아마 그것도 허락해주지 않을겁니다.

방화벽 보다 더 위험하니까요.


내부망에서 보안 체널을 쓰는 것은 모니터링을 못하기 때문에 보안상 안 좋다고 하더라고요.

박성철(gyumee)님이 2008-04-02 15:50에 작성한 댓글입니다.
[Top]
No.
제목
작성자
작성일
조회
7389삼항연산 같은 것은 없나요? [4]
심상호
2008-04-07
7699
7388md5() 가 아닌 sha 함수 존재하나요? [3]
김종화
2008-04-02
6199
7387서버에서 원격디비서버로 데이타 인서트시 [4]
영광
2008-04-02
5821
7386DMZ zone에 있는 web server에서 내부망에 있는 DB를 사용하는데 [3]
박성철
2008-04-01
7469
7385드디어 PostgreSQL도 호스팅 하는 업체가... [2]
박성철
2008-03-31
6550
7384DB명을 모를 경우 백업 방법은?? [6]
김상훈
2008-03-27
8237
7383왜 PostgreSQL 은 무료인가요? 급 궁금 ^^;; [5]
김일권
2008-03-24
9823
Valid XHTML 1.0!
All about the DATABASE... Copyleft 1999-2024 DSN, All rights reserved.
작업시간: 0.017초, 이곳 서비스는
	PostgreSQL v16.2로 자료를 관리합니다